To be honest with you it all depends on what product you are wanting to advertise.

No point in advertising a fetish product on a site that has a small base of fetish webmasters etc.

I would suggest going to google and doing some searches for resources based on your product and then, take a look through those sites and see what they offer in exchange.

For example, if you have a content company, you might do a search on 'adult content providers' or, 'content providers', 'adult content' etc.

If you were going to be advertising something related to traffic, you might like to do a search on 'adult traffic sources' 'adult traffic resources' etc etc.

If you are marketing something to the international webmasters a search for 'foreign resources', 'international adult webmasters' etc should yield some good results.

In general, a lot of resources get a lot of traffic however, the more highly targeted that traffic is for YOU the better your ad results will be overall.
